Assuming they are all the same, I just flip the lid off the fob (flick the metal key out and pull/pry the exposed ridge of the cover), pop out the old one and slip in the new one, and press the lid back on.

Mine is like this one...
https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=uxR6FvgiVeo

There is no coding it just works, but probably best to do it within 5 minutes, not take out the battery and then order one and wait for it to come. It is a CR2032
